On 11 Oct, 22:08, Mark Murphy <[email protected]> wrote: > Lee Jarvis wrote: > > Hi guys, I have a small test application that simply grabs a URL from > > an EditText box, before downloading the page source for the URL, > > prompting the user to ask if it should display the contents, then > > doing so, or returning state. > > > I would like to incorporate a ProgressDialog to appear whilst the GET > > request is in action. I understand this would require threads, and I > > have attempted to implement this, but to no avail. Could anyone assist > > in this matter? > > Use AsyncTask. Open the ProgressDialog in onPreExecute() or before you > start the AsyncTask. Do the HTTP request in doInBackground().
